Crystal Chemistry of Stanfieldite, Ca<sub>7</sub><i>M</i><sub>2</sub>Mg<sub>9</sub>(PO<sub>4</sub>)<sub>12</sub> (<i>M</i> = Ca, Mg, Fe<sup>2+</sup>), a Structural Base of Ca<sub>3</sub>Mg<sub>3</sub>(PO<sub>4</sub>)<sub>4</sub> Phosphors
Stanfieldite, natural Ca-Mg-phosphate, is a typical constituent of phosphate-phosphide assemblages in pallasite and mesosiderite meteorites.
